Interesujące zestawy odpowiedzi. Ale niektóre nadal wprowadzają w błąd. Spróbuję podsumować.
Absolutnie nie
1) Otwarcie pliku w żaden sposób go nie usuwa. Również go zamykam. Nie w przeglądarce ani programie do edycji.
Istnieje szansa, że plik różni się w różnych programach, ale może to być spowodowane tym, że ten program interpretuje niektóre informacje, takie jak tryb kolorów lub profil kolorów. Ale ten proces to tylko czytanie.
Istnieje szansa na małe zmiany
2) Wykonywanie operacji bez losowych, takich jak obracanie obrazu. Zwykle programy po prostu ponownie zamawiają dane pliku jpg, bez analizowania i ponownej kompresji. Ale nie postawiłbym rąk na ogień dla wszystkich programów, które mają to zrobić.
Niewielkie nieuzasadnione zmiany
3) Otwieranie i zapisywanie z tą samą kompresją w tym samym programie.
Pierwsza rekompresja odbywa się przy pierwszym zapisaniu pliku jpg. Jeśli plik zostanie zapisany po raz drugi z tymi samymi ustawieniami, pierwotna utrata danych już się zakończyła, ale niewielkie zmiany można zastosować ponownie. Nie w takim samym stopniu jak pierwszy, ale zauważalne jest robienie tego kilka razy. Ale to zależy od programu.
Zauważalne zmiany
4) Najbardziej oczywistym jest oszczędzanie przy innym ustawieniu kompresji.
Nie tylko w „skali” na czymkolwiek ma program, ale także zastosowany algorytm. Jest to trochę zbyt techniczne, ale istnieją co najmniej dwa główne algorytmy kompresji 4: 4: 4 i 4: 2: 2.
Możesz użyć „suwaka” w swoim programie, aby uzyskać najwyższą „jakość”, ale jeśli twój program używa 4: 2: 2, a oryginał był w formacie 4: 4: 4, będziesz miał znaczną utratę danych.
Oto mały artykuł, który napisałem kilka lat temu, abyś mógł zobaczyć, co oznacza utrata danych, jest w języku hiszpańskim, ale możesz użyć tłumaczenia google: http://otake.com.mx/Apuntes/PruebasDeCompresion2/1-CompresionJpgProceso.htm
Całkowity bałagan
5) Jeśli otworzysz obraz i zapiszesz go ponownie w programie, który ma ograniczone możliwości. Na przykład viwer może tylko zapisywać pliki RGB i nie działać poprawnie z plikami CMYK, a może nie rozumie osadzonego profilu kolorów. Możesz całkowicie zepsuć swój obraz po zapisaniu.
6) Korzystanie z dużej kompresji. Zapisujesz go na swojej stronie i kompresujesz. Nie usuwaj oryginałów pease!
Tylko w edytowanej części obrazu
7) Rekompresja jest zwykle wykonywana na całym obrazie, ale jak wspomniałem w punkcie 3, nie jest to dużo, jeśli obraz się nie zmienił. Kiedy edytujesz obraz, analiza musi zostać wykonana ponownie w tym edytowanym fragmencie.
Pamiętaj, że edycję można podzielić na trzy grupy.
a) Korekty kolorów, kontrast itp.
b) Zmiana jednej części obrazu (czerwone oczy, usunięcie osoby, czyszczenie niepożądanych miejsc)
c) Całkowicie nowy kolaż.
Tak więc w niektórych przypadkach obraz jest zupełnie inny, przynajmniej z punktu widzenia analizy i rekompresji.
W tym poście: /photo//a/67434/37321 użytkownik wspomniał o programie, który wykonuje bardzo sprytną analizę istniejącej kompresji i nie kompresuje jej ponownie, jeśli nie jest to konieczne.